Understanding 4K60 Multi-Picture Split Processors
Before diving into specific products, it’s essential to understand what a 4K60 multi-picture split processor is and how it functions. These devices allow users to connect multiple HDMI sources and display them simultaneously on a single screen or across multiple screens. The term '4K60' refers to a resolution of 3840 x 2160 pixels at a refresh rate of 60 Hz, offering clear and smooth visuals ideal for high-definition content. The processors typically support various output configurations, including Picture-in-Picture (PIP), split-screen, and grid displays.
These devices are vital for various applications, including:
- Corporate presentations and multimedia conferences
- Live sports broadcasts and events
- Gaming setups where multiple sources are monitored
- Security monitoring systems

Buyer’s Guide: Choosing the Right Multi-Picture Split Processor
When selecting a 4K60 multi-picture split processor, consider the following factors:
- Input/Output Needs: Assess how many HDMI sources you need to connect and how many screens you plan to use. Options like the BIT-Ma-U1-MC0808 are ideal for 8-source setups, while the 12x12 controller is suited for larger arrays.
- Seamless Switching: Look for processors with seamless switching capabilities to prevent delays during transitions. This feature is crucial for live events or high-stakes presentations.
- Control Options: Ensure the device has multiple control options, such as remote control and app integration. This allows for greater flexibility and convenience during use.
- Resolution Support: Confirm that the processor supports the resolutions you need. For high-definition displays, 4K60 support is essential to maintain quality.
- Application Suitability: Consider where the device will be used. Applications can include commercial environments, educational settings, gaming, or home theaters.
